According to the public record, 17, Forest Mead, St. Helens is a leasehold house.
By comparing it to neighbours, we estimate that it is a mid-century house with 1,026 ft2 of internal area and sits on a 324 m2 plot and a garden.
Houses of this size in this area normally have 3 bedrooms.
Based on available information, and assuming reasonable condition, the estimated sale value for 17, Forest Mead, St. Helens is £284,281 and the estimated rental value is £1,398 per month.

Decorative condition can have a big effect on a property's value and this effect varies depending on the type, size and location of the property.
If 17, Forest Mead, St. Helens is in very good condition we estimate a sale value of £298,495 and a rental value of £1,468 per month.
However, if the property needs a lot of cosmetic work we estimate a sale value of £264,381 and a rental value of £1,300 per month.
Over the last 12 months the sale value of 17 Forest Mead St. Helens has increased by an estimated £9,283 (3.3%) and its rental value has increased by an estimated £43 per month (3.1%), giving an expected gross yield of 5.9%.

According to HM Land Registry, 17, Forest Mead, St. Helens was last sold on 25th May 2012 for £179,500 and was recorded as a leasehold house.
The property has only had this single sale since 1995.
Since May 2012, the market for similar properties has risen 62.9%
